Nine people arrested for trafficking women

A shocking case of human trafficking in Bahrain has recently been exposed, involving a network of individuals exploiting four Asian women who were lured to the country with promises of legitimate jobs. The victims were forced into prostitution after arriving in Bahrain, with their passports being confiscated and threats of being sold to other sex traffickers if they did not comply. The operation was masterminded by a 46-year-old woman, who was eventually apprehended by the police.

The investigation into the human trafficking case began after a complaint was filed by the embassy of one of the Asian countries, alleging that the victims were being held captive and forced into sex work. The first victim, a 39-year-old woman, shared her story of being promised a job as a masseuse but ending up in a hotel room with other women of the same nationality, being informed that she was expected to engage in prostitution. When she refused, she was threatened with extortion or being sold to other traffickers.

The victims were held captive in hotel rooms until they could contact their embassies for help. The second victim, also 39 years old, confirmed the first victim’s account of being deceived and forced into prostitution upon arrival in Bahrain. The suspects involved in the trafficking operation included seven women and two men, one of whom was a Bahraini national. The victims were manipulated and exploited by this network, who subjected them to coercive tactics to keep them compliant.

The individuals responsible for operating the human trafficking ring were arrested by the Bahraini authorities, including the mastermind behind the scheme. The investigation was initiated after the victims sought help from their respective embassies, leading to the rescue of the women from their captors.
